Shuffle left algorithm

WebPossible algorithms ; Shuffle-left ; Copy-over ; Converging-pointers; 24 The Shuffle-Left Algorithm. Scan list from left to right ; When a zero is found, shift all values to its right one … Web2. Do Lab Experience 5 As Pictured Below: Exercise 5.1. Running the Shuffle-Left animation Follow the instructions in the lab manual. Exercise 5.2. Stepping with the Shuffle-Left animation Follow the instructions in the lab manual. Exercise 5.3. Copy operations and positions of 0s Record below the location of the 0s in the original data set. Now step …

Analysis of Algorithms: Data Cleanup Algorithms - GitHub Pages

WebRubik's Cube Algorithms. A Rubik's Cube algorithm is an operation on the puzzle which reorients its pieces in a certain way. Mathematically the Rubik's Cube is a permutation … WebAug 3, 2024 · There are two ways to shuffle an array in Java. Collections.shuffle () Method. Random Class. 1. Shuffle Array Elements using Collections Class. We can create a list … how do you pass gas https://emailmit.com

Lab Experience Eleven.docx - Course Hero

WebMiller Shuffle Algorithm: A new Shuffle algorithm that does not require a persistent data structure resource or give out premature repeats. ... There was a chunk left out due to … WebSpotify shuffle has been proven without a doubt to both break obviously like mine or more subtlely like OPs. The algorithm definitely is a self-fulfilling prophecy that weighs songs … WebNov 7, 2024 · Even though the random library already has a shuffle() function to shuffle the content of a list, we will ignore this function and create our own algorithm to shuffle the content of our deck of cards. We … phone in clifton nj new jersey

How to Solve Slide Puzzles: Beginner Tricks and …

Category:algorithm - Check if a string is a shuffle of two other given strings ...

Tags:Shuffle left algorithm

Shuffle left algorithm

Solved > 21. The ____ case of an algorithm:1431489 ... ScholarOn

WebSep 3, 2024 · This page compares the algorithm you mention with Knuth's, showing why Knuth's is better.. Note: the below might be wrong, see the comments. I'm not aware of an easy way to compute the probability you ask about and I can't seem to find any simple explanation either, but the idea is that your algorithm (usually referred to as the naive … WebApr 5, 2024 · Method #2 : Using random.shuffle () This is most recommended method to shuffle a list. Python in its random library provides this inbuilt function which in-place shuffles the list. Drawback of this is that list ordering is lost in this process. Useful for developers who choose to save time and hustle.

Shuffle left algorithm

Did you know?

WebShuffle left algorithm: L marker moves to the right trying to detect 0s. Each time it detects a 0, the R marker moves to the right, shuffling the data items to the left. Get the array, A and … WebRearranges the elements in the range [first,last) randomly, using g as uniform random number generator. The function swaps the value of each element with that of some other …

WebJul 25, 2024 · Then the shuffle array would be randomly sorted with any algorithm; The shuffle array is stored in eg. a text file for persistence, which is loaded at session start; … WebShuffle-Left Algorithm (Fig 3.1) Exercising the Shuffle-Left Algorithm Efficiency of Shuffle-Left Space: no extra space (except few variables) Time Best-case No zero value: no …

WebThis algorithm is called a random shuffle algorithm or a shuffle algorithm. This paper is divided into two parts, the first part of the most commonly used shuffle algorithm. … WebOct 10, 2012 · Fisher–Yates shuffle Algorithm works in O (n) time complexity. The assumption here is, we are given a function rand () that generates a random number in O (1) time. The idea is to start from the last element and swap it with a randomly selected … Space Complexity: O(1) Note : Output will be different each time because of the …

WebExpert Answer. Answer 1 Number of copy operations using shuffle -left algorithm. During first round when the first zero is found in position 47. no of copy operations will be n-k. …

Weba shuffle function that doesn't change the source array. Update: Here I'm suggesting a relatively simple (not from complexity perspective) and short algorithm that will do just … how do you pass in tecmo bowlWebApr 5, 2024 · Method #2 : Using random.shuffle () This is most recommended method to shuffle a list. Python in its random library provides this inbuilt function which in-place … phone in condomWebMar 11, 2024 · Shuffle Algorithm: Naive Approach. My first approach was a naive one which involved using the delete function. def bad_shuffle (array) arr = array.dup new_arr = [] until … phone in clothes dryerWebIt can helps in fault tolerance and reduce the latency. The shuffle exchange multistage interconnection network is one network in large class topologically equivalent MINs that … phone in darkWebMay 22, 2024 · Let L be the weight of the tree’s left subtree and w be the weight of the root. Recursively use this procedure to select a node: If x < L, move left and recursively select a … phone in coldWebMar 11, 2024 · Shuffle Algorithm: Naive Approach. My first approach was a naive one which involved using the delete function. def bad_shuffle (array) arr = array.dup new_arr = [] until arr.empty? i = rand (arr.length) new_arr << arr.delete_at (i) end new_arr end. This was really slow and by isolating lines in the code I was able to discover that it was slow ... phone in couchWebAug 4, 2024 · There are shuffling algorithms in existence that runs faster and gives consistent results. These algorithms rely on randomization to generate a unique random … phone in creole